I have been oil free for 5 weeks and believe this is the right way to live. But I realize this is a controversial issue among health educators. Just today, I was talking with a health ministries director who shared this with me, "Extra virgin olive oil contains 34 different antioxidants including hydroxytyrosol which softens arterial walls. There are oils which are very good when not used in excess. Those who use this approach in very extreme cardiac cases get success but there are also studies which show that no oil can increase heart attack risk."

What are your thoughts on this?

Oil is 4,000 calories per pound.  It is as high fat of a food as you can ever eat. For those trying to watch their weight oil is not helpful. It will increase the battle of the bulge. :-(

For those trying to prevent and/or reverse diabetes it is a not helpful. It will create insulin resistance. 

Oil, as found in the olive is beneficial. But, pressing the oil from the olive is not. You get almost none of the nutrition and all of the fat.
